簡體   English   中英

立即窗口無法在名稱空間中找到類

[英]Immediate window cannot find class in namespace

我的代碼中有一個這樣定位的方法

namespace DMR
{
    public static class MyClass
    {
        public static void MyMethod()
        {
            // Do stuff here
            // (...)
        }
    }
}

我嘗試使用以下命令從即時窗口調用它:

DMR.MyClass.MyMethod();

返回名稱空間錯誤:

類型或名稱空間名稱“ MyClass”在名稱空間“ ProjectName.DMR”中不存在

我也嘗試在調用中的名稱空間前添加項目名稱,但這並沒有改變任何內容。 我也許應該注意,命名空間與文件夾名稱不同,因為文件夾名稱是在創建后更改的(不更改命名空間),所以我不知道這是否有效果。

我究竟做錯了什么?

我決定更改名稱空間以匹配文件夾名稱。 這使它起作用。 我仍然不知道為什么文件的文件夾名稱和名稱空間必須相同,所以如果有人對此進行解釋,那將是很好的。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M